Can GeForce GTX 1060 run Pixeplorer?

Great

The GeForce GTX 1060 handles Pixeplorer well at 1080p, delivering approximately 789 FPS at High settings — above the 60 FPS target for smooth gameplay. It can also achieve smooth 1440p at around 591 FPS.

About

Pixeplorer is designed to be accessible, making it a great choice for gamers with entry-level hardware. With a minimum requirement of GPUs like the GTX 1650 or RX 6500 XT, players can expect smooth gameplay at lower settings. For those operating on integrated graphics or older GPUs, performance may be limited, but the game is built to run on modest systems, allowing for an enjoyable experience even with basic hardware.

For optimal performance, targeting 1080p resolution with medium settings is advisable if you're using a GTX 1660 or RX 6600. Higher-end GPUs, such as the RTX 3060 or RX 6700 XT, can comfortably handle 1440p at high settings, giving players a vibrant experience in the pixelated worlds. Overall, Pixeplorer is a well-optimized title that caters to a wide range of systems, making it an ideal pick for casual gamers and indie enthusiasts alike.
